    Jawan Movie Review Rating: ⭐⭐⭐⭐ | 4/5

    Jawan Movie Cast: Shah Rukh Khan, Nayanthara, Vijay Sethupathi, Priyamani, Sunil Grover, Ridhi Dogra, Sanya Malhotra, Sanjeeta Bhattacharya, Girija Oak, Lehar Khan, Yogi Babu, Eijaz Khan, Thalapathy Vijay, Sanjay Dutt, Deepika Padukone and the others

    Jawan Movie Director: Atlee

    Jawan Movie Plot: A man, fueled by a deep-seated vendetta and bound by an unbreakable promise from years past, embarks on a relentless mission to correct the injustices plaguing society. Along his path, he confronts a formidable outlaw, a merciless force of nature, who has inflicted unimaginable agony upon countless individuals.

    Jawan Movie Review

    Jawan is a scorching action thriller that delivers on multiple fronts, earning a solid 4 out of 5 stars. This film, directed by Atlee and featuring an ensemble cast led by Shah Rukh Khan and Nayanthara, keeps viewers on the edge of their seats from start to finish.

    One of the standout aspects of the movie is Shah Rukh Khan’s compelling dual role as Vikram Rathore and Azad Rathore. His portrayal is a delightful mix of menace and charm, offering fans a variety of captivating moments.

    Nayanthara, in her Bollywood debut, shines as the lady superstar of the South. Her beauty and acting prowess make her a captivating presence throughout the film, leaving audiences eagerly anticipating her future projects in Hindi cinema.

    Vijay Sethupathi’s performance as the antagonist Kalee is a highlight of Jawan. His powerful dialogue delivery and ominous presence establish him as one of the industry’s top villains.

    The film also benefits from notable cameos by Deepika Padukone, Thalapathy Vijay, and Sanjay Dutt, adding depth to the overall plot. The ensemble cast, including Priyamani, Ridhi Dogra, and others, adds an extra layer of intrigue, with Sanya Malhotra making a commendable contribution to the narrative.

    Atlee’s direction showcases a different side of Shah Rukh Khan, and his handling of the minor characters is praiseworthy. Cinematographer G.K. Vishnu’s work contributes to the film’s visual appeal, creating a seamless flow of action sequences that captivate the audience.

    The plot of Jawan is woven in an engaging manner, ensuring that the nearly three-hour runtime never feels dull. The film maintains a quick pace, transitioning smoothly from one scene to another, keeping viewers eagerly anticipating each unfolding event.

    In summary, Jawan is a must-watch action thriller that offers electrifying pacing, a star-studded cast, and an interesting premise. Shah Rukh Khan’s dual role, Nayanthara’s captivating performance, and Vijay Sethupathi’s menacing presence make this film a memorable experience. Atlee’s direction and G.K. Vishnu’s cinematography elevate the overall quality of the movie, ensuring there’s never a dull moment. Jawan deserves to be experienced on the big screen.
